Key Initiatives in Environmental Monitoring

1. Qatar’s Environmental Monitoring System: Qatar has implemented a comprehensive environmental monitoring system encompassing various environmental aspects. This system gathers crucial data and provides valuable insights for informed decision-making. The monitoring network consists of the following:

    • Air Quality Monitoring Stations: Qatar has established a nationwide network of air quality monitoring stations. These stations continuously measure air pollutants, including particulate matter, nitrogen dioxide, and ozone. The collected data helps assess air quality and identify areas where interventions are needed to mitigate pollution.
    • Water Quality Monitoring Buoys: Water quality monitoring buoys have been deployed to monitor the water quality in Qatar’s coastal areas. These buoys collect temperature, salinity, dissolved oxygen, and nutrient levels data. This information aids in understanding the health of marine ecosystems and enables the timely detection of pollution events or changes in water quality.
    • Weather Monitoring Stations: Qatar’s weather monitoring stations provide real-time data on various meteorological parameters like temperature, humidity, wind speed, and precipitation. This data is crucial for climate monitoring, forecasting extreme weather events, and understanding local weather patterns.

2. Wildlife Conservation Programs: Qatar has undertaken several initiatives to monitor and protect endangered species. Prominent programs include:

    • Arabian Oryx Conservation: The Arabian oryx, a symbol of Qatar’s wildlife heritage, faced near extinction in the wild. Qatar launched a conservation program to breed and reintroduce this iconic species into protected areas. Monitoring is vital in tracking the oryx population, studying their behavior, and ensuring their successful reintroduction into their natural habitat.
    • Hawksbill Turtle Protection: Qatar’s coastal areas serve as important nesting sites for the endangered hawksbill turtles. Conservation efforts involve monitoring nesting beaches, implementing protection measures, and studying turtle migration patterns. Tracking devices like satellite tags help monitor their movements, identify critical habitats, and contribute to conservation strategies.

Technological Advancements in Environmental Monitoring

1. Remote Sensing and Satellite Imagery: Remote sensing and satellite imagery are crucial in monitoring Qatar’s environment and understanding changes in its natural landscapes. Here are some key applications:

      • Land Use Monitoring: Satellite data provides valuable information on Qatar’s land use and cover changes. This helps monitor urban expansion, agricultural practices, and changes in natural habitats. By analyzing satellite imagery, authorities can identify areas at risk of degradation or encroachment and take appropriate conservation measures.
      • Vegetation Health Assessment: Remote sensing enables monitoring of vegetation health and biomass estimation. By analyzing vegetation indices derived from satellite data, such as the Normalized Difference Vegetation Index (NDVI), Qatar can assess the health of its vegetation, track changes over time, and detect areas susceptible to drought or degradation.
      • Environmental Impact Assessment: Remote sensing assists in conducting environmental impact assessments for development projects. By comparing pre- and post-construction satellite images, authorities can evaluate the environmental changes brought about by infrastructure development, such as changes in land cover, habitat fragmentation, and ecosystem disruption.

Collaborative Approaches and Future Outlook

  1. International Partnerships: Qatar recognizes the importance of international collaboration in addressing environmental challenges beyond national borders. The country partners with international organizations and neighboring countries to exchange knowledge, share best practices, and tackle transboundary environmental issues. Through these collaborations, Qatar can benefit from global expertise, access cutting-edge technologies, and work collectively towards shared environmental goals. Examples of partnerships include collaborations with organizations like the United Nations Environment Programme (UNEP), the International Union for Conservation of Nature (IUCN), and regional initiatives like the Gulf Cooperation Council (GCC) for the environment.
